Exercise
Exercise is critical to healthy living for a multitude of reasons. We all know that. Unfortunately for MCS sufferers, too much exercise makes us sick. It's a fine line between not enough exercise and too much exercise.
Start out with just a light work out of just a three minutes. Add one to two minutes of exercise to your work outs about every week. So, week one you might only do three minutes of exercise a day, most days. Week two, you might do four or five minutes of exercise a day, most days. And so on.
You don't have to work out for very long to get good conditioning. 20-30 minutes a day is plenty. New studies indicate that you can get the same result working out 10 minutes, 2-3 times a day.
Resistance training is important to maintaining proper bone density however it also creates toxins in your muscles. Start out with aerobic exercise like light walking. Then after several weeks add some light resistance training. Be very careful not to over do it!
Try to maintain ideal conditions in your environment all the time if you are going to be working out. Also make sure to take your treatment protocol supplements. The goal is to give yourself the best possible chance of succeeding in an exercise program so you can enjoy its many health benefits.
